Star of David and Torah on Cover. Jewish oil magic and the Talmudic prayers in Hebrew and English translation as well as history of the material and text. Rare primary magical material with translation. Printed by letter press by Horace Hart at the Oxford University Press. Original grey printed light card wraps. The author (1878-1949) was lecturer in Biblical Exegesis, Midrash and Talmud aat Jews' College, which was founded as a rabbinical seminary and day-school for Jewish boys in 1855 and survives today as the London School of Jewish Studies. Daiches wrote several other works on the history of Jews in Iraq and was honoured by a festschrift entitled "Ye Are My Witnesses" in 1936. Seller Inventory # 008261
